Unlocking Writing Skills with the Right Writing Worksheet for 1st Grade
Choosing the right writing worksheet for 1st grade involves thinking about what skills your child is currently developing. Is it sentence structure, story sequencing, or descriptive writing? Focus on worksheets that target specific areas they need to improve. This makes learning effective and efficient.
One great way to make learning fun is through themed worksheets! Think of dinosaurs, animals, or even their favorite cartoon characters. These themes spark their imagination and make them more excited to write. They will learn while having a blast, and thats what we all want, right?
Don’t be afraid to mix things up! Try worksheets that incorporate drawing prompts or creative writing exercises. Instead of only filling in the blanks, encourage them to create their own stories and illustrations. This kind of activity unlocks their creativity and helps them think outside the box.
Don’t just rely on worksheets as the only learning tool. Supplement them with other activities like reading aloud and storytelling. Encourage your child to write in a journal or create their own little books. Make writing a part of their everyday routine. This will reinforce learning and growth.
Remember, the goal is to foster a love of writing in your child. Start with shorter, simpler activities and gradually increase the challenge as they progress. Celebrate their efforts and accomplishments along the way, no matter how small. Patience and encouragement are key!
